How to Use Glycolic Acid Cream 12%
- Use only at night on clean, dry skin
- Apply a pea-sized amount to affected areas
- Do not use near eyes, lips, or broken skin
- Follow with moisturiser if dryness occurs
- Always apply sunscreen (SPF 30+) the next morning
Start 2–3 nights a week, then increase as tolerated.
Glycolic Acid vs Tretinoin vs Azelaic Acid
| Feature | Glycolic Acid | Tretinoin | Azelaic Acid |
|---|---|---|---|
| Strength Type | AHA Exfoliant | Vitamin A Retinoid | Dicarboxylic Acid |
| Best Use | Texture, Pigmentation | Anti-aging, Acne | Redness, Sensitivity |
| Skin Tolerance | Medium | Low | High |
| Prescription | No | Yes | No |

Frequently Asked Questions
1. Can I use Glycolic Acid Cream every day?
Start gradually (2–3 times weekly) and increase based on tolerance.
2. Do I need to use sunscreen while using it?
Yes. Sunscreen is essential when using exfoliating acids.
3. Can I mix Glycolic Acid with Tretinoin?
Not on the same night. Alternate to prevent irritation.
4. Is it suitable for acne-prone skin?
Yes, it may improve visible texture and post-breakout marks.
